What does a prototype development engineer do?

A Prototype Development Engineer is responsible for designing, building, and testing prototypes of new products or components. They collaborate with product designers, engineers, and manufacturing teams to turn concepts into functional models. Their work involves using CAD software, selecting appropriate materials, and troubleshooting issues that arise during development. The goal is to evaluate and refine ideas before mass production to ensure the product meets performance, safety, and quality standards.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a prototype development engineer?

To thrive as a Prototype Development Engineer, you need strong engineering fundamentals, hands-on fabrication skills, and a degree in mechanical, electrical, or related engineering fields. Familiarity with CAD software, rapid prototyping tools like 3D printers, and experience with testing equipment are typically required. Creative problem-solving, attention to detail, and effective communication are essential soft skills in this role. These abilities ensure prototypes are innovative, functional, and aligned with project goals, driving successful development cycles.

What are some common challenges prototype development engineers face when transitioning from concept to functional prototype?

Prototype Development Engineers often encounter challenges such as translating abstract design concepts into practical, manufacturable prototypes within tight timelines. Balancing innovative ideas with material limitations, cost constraints, and technical feasibility can be demanding. Additionally, effective collaboration with design, manufacturing, and testing teams is crucial to quickly resolve unforeseen issues and iterate on solutions. Staying adaptable and maintaining clear communication helps overcome these obstacles and ensures successful prototype delivery.

What is the difference between Prototype Development Engineer vs Mechanical Design Engineer?

AspectPrototype Development EngineerMechanical Design Engineer
Primary FocusCreating physical prototypes to test concepts and functionalitiesDesigning detailed mechanical components and systems
Skills & CertificationsPrototyping tools, CAD, materials knowledge, engineering fundamentalsCAD, mechanical design, analysis, certifications like EIT or PE
Work EnvironmentLaboratories, prototyping workshops, manufacturing settingsDesign offices, CAD labs, engineering departments
Industry UsageProduct development, R&D, manufacturingProduct design, mechanical systems, engineering firms

While both roles involve engineering skills and CAD proficiency, Prototype Development Engineers focus on building and testing physical models to validate concepts, whereas Mechanical Design Engineers concentrate on creating detailed mechanical designs and specifications. The roles often collaborate during product development cycles but serve different stages of the process.
